The initial and most typical type of attic room insulation is fiberglass batt insulation. It looks incredibly like cotton-candy and clouds, and it's likely the photo you imagine when a person says "attic room insulation." Its appeal has actually stayed stable for years, and it is a company favorite among home owners. Fiberglass is basically tiny slivers of glass fibers, which, before being made into glass, was originally sand and recycled product.

This attic room insulation is additionally blown-in using a blowing device, nonetheless the product used is various. The product utilized here is cellulose. This is made from all various recycled material, including things constructed out of timber, newspapers, and cardboard. Boric acid and various other substances are applied to flame-proof the attic insulation.

Is blown-in cellulose insulation worth it? Right here's what it can provide your household: Generally, blown-in cellulose is much better for the planet. With cellulose being made from simply reused material, there's no requirement to create new material. Reusing this is green. The boric acid and other materials assist to flame proof the insulation and slow down the spread of fires.


Blown-in cellulose insulation has an R-Value that is 23 percent greater than fiberglass batts. Cellulose also aids lower wind-washing. What are the disadvantages of setting up blown-in cellulose insulation in your attic? Right here are the drawbacks: Cellulose is environmentally friendly, however the further materials that are added are not. Boron is called for to produce boric acid, and the mining procedure that mines boron is unsafe to the setting.

Unlike all the other sorts of attic insulation, spray foam insulation is the only kind ahead as a liquid. After being sprayed, it enlarges and expands, and afterwards establishes as a durable foam. This foam slides nicely right into any kind of voids, locking closed, and cuts off any retreat paths for your heating.


Lastly, what are the drawbacks of spray foam insulation?: The in advance payment for spray foam insulation is greater than the other kinds of attic insulation on our checklist. It's worth taking into consideration that, due to high levels of power effectiveness, it'll likely stabilize out or also end up being less costly in the long-run to keep your home warm.
